Aspects Influencing Cat Flap Installation Price
Several crucial aspects figure out the total cost of installing a cat flap. Being mindful of these components will assist you comprehend the quotes you get and make notified choices to potentially handle expenses.
1. Kind Of Cat Flap:
The market provides a varied series of cat flaps, from standard manual designs to sophisticated wise variations. The type you pick will substantially impact the installation price and, naturally, the price of the flap itself.
- Fundamental Cat Flaps: These are the easiest and most cost effective options. They typically include a swinging flap that opens when pushed by your cat. Installation is generally straightforward and less expensive, specifically into wooden doors.
- Magnetic Cat Flaps: These flaps include a magnetic collar tag for your cat. The flap only opens when the magnet is found, preventing undesirable area cats from getting in. They are somewhat more costly than standard flaps and installation expenses can be marginally higher.
- Microchip Cat Flaps: These advanced flaps use your cat's existing microchip to manage access. They provide superior security and avoid entry from any cat without a registered microchip. These are considerably more pricey flaps, and the installation can be more complex, particularly if professional shows is required.
- Smart Cat Flaps: These high-grade flaps typically consist of features like timers, curfew settings, and mobile phone connectivity for monitoring your cat's comings and goings. Smart flaps are the most pricey and installation can be the most complex, possibly requiring electrical connections or specialized setups.
2. Material of Installation Surface:
The material into which the cat flap is being set up greatly influences the labor required and hence, the price.
- Wood Doors: Wooden doors are generally the simplest and least pricey to install a cat flap into. Wood is fairly simple to cut and work with, resulting in lower labor costs.
- UPVC/Metal Doors: UPVC and metal doors are more challenging than wood. They need customized tools and strategies for cutting, possibly increasing labor expenses.
- Glass Doors/Panels: Installing a cat flap into glass needs specialist abilities and tools. It often involves changing a glass panel with one that has a pre-cut hole, as toughened glass can not be cut. This is usually the most expensive installation alternative due to specialist labor and material expenses (new glass panel).
- Walls (Brick/Concrete): Installing a cat flap through a wall is significantly more complicated and labor-intensive. It involves drilling through brick or concrete, potentially requiring lintel assistance and weatherproofing. Wall setups are generally the most pricey after glass installations.
3. Complexity of Installation:
The complexity of the installation itself also affects the price.
- Basic Door Installation: A straightforward installation into a standard wood door is usually considered the least complex and for that reason, less costly.
- Thick Walls or Doors: Extremely thick walls or doors might need extensions for the cat flap tunnel, contributing to the cost.
- Awkward Locations: Installing a cat door mounting flap in a difficult-to-reach location or where there are blockages may increase labor time and hence, the price.
- Weatherproofing and Finishing: Ensuring the installation is properly weatherproofed and finished nicely (particularly in walls) will contribute to the total cost.
4. Geographic Location:
Labor costs vary throughout various areas. Installation rates in urban locations or regions with a greater cost of living are most likely to be more pricey than in backwoods.

Types of Cat Flaps and Estimated Price Ranges (Including Installation)
To give you a clearer photo of the expenses, here's a breakdown of different cat flap types and approximated price ranges including professional installation. These are general quotes and can differ based upon the aspects mentioned above.
- Standard Cat Flap Installation (Wooden Door): ₤ 70 - ₤ 150
- Flap Cost: ₤ 10 - ₤ 30
- Installation Cost: ₤ 60 - ₤ 120
- Magnetic Cat Flap Installation (Wooden Door): ₤ 90 - ₤ 200
- Flap Cost: ₤ 30 - ₤ 60
- Installation Cost: ₤ 60 - ₤ 140
- Microchip Cat Flap Installation (Wooden Door): ₤ 150 - ₤ 350
- Flap Cost: ₤ 80 - ₤ 200
- Installation Cost: ₤ 70 - ₤ 150 (may be higher for intricate programming)
- Smart Cat Flap Installation (Wooden Door): ₤ 250 - ₤ 500+
- Flap Cost: ₤ 150 - ₤ 300+
- Installation Cost: ₤ 100 - ₤ 200+ (potentially greater with electrical work and app setup)
- Cat Flap Installation in UPVC/Metal Door: Add roughly ₤ 20 - ₤ 50 to the wood door costs above, depending upon intricacy.
- Cat Flap Installation in Glass Door/Panel: ₤ 250 - ₤ 600+
- This cost greatly depends upon the size and type of glass panel requiring replacement. Glass replacement itself can vary considerably in price.
- Cat Flap Installation through a Wall: ₤ 200 - ₤ 500+
- This is extremely variable depending upon wall thickness, material, completing requirements, and any required lintel assistance.
Please Note: These are approximated ranges. It is constantly best to get particular quotes from local specialists for precise rates tailored to your circumstance.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s) About Cat Flap Installation Price
Q: What is the average cost of cat flap installation?A: The typical cost varies commonly depending upon the type of cat flap and installation surface. For a basic cat flap in a wood door, anticipate to pay between ₤ 70 and ₤ 150 consisting of installation. More complex installations and advanced cat flaps can cost considerably more.
Q: Do cat flap installation expenses differ by location?A: Yes, labor expenses and product prices fluctuate geographically. Urban areas and regions with a higher cost of living typically have higher installation rates.
Q: Is it less expensive to set up a cat flap myself?A: Potentially, you can minimize labor expenses by DIY installation. Nevertheless, this is just a good idea if you are confident in your DIY skills and have the needed tools. Mistakes can be pricey to repair, and professional installation frequently offers much better outcomes and assurance.
Q: How long does cat flap installation take?A: A basic wood door installation can frequently be finished in under an hour. More intricate installations, such as wall or glass setups, will take longer and may need multiple visits.
Q: What kind of cat flap is most expensive to set up?A: Smart cat flaps are usually the most expensive to set up due to their higher cost and potentially more complicated setup. Glass and wall setups are also generally more pricey than basic door installations.

Q: Will a cat flap installation affect my home insurance?A: In many cases, a basic cat flap installation will not straight impact your home insurance. However, it's always a good idea to contact your insurance coverage provider to validate if there are any particular stipulations or requirements, particularly if you are installing a wise cat flap or in a susceptible location.
